The Evolution of Digital Fishing Games: Industry Insights and Future Directions

In recent years, the landscape of online gaming has undergone a remarkable transformation, particularly within the niche of fishing-themed digital entertainment. Once confined to simple simulations, fishing games have now evolved into sophisticated, immersive experiences powered by cutting-edge technology and consumer data analytics. As the UK digital gaming market continues its upward trajectory, understanding these trends is crucial for industry stakeholders, developers, and enthusiasts alike.

Market Growth and Consumer Engagement in Fishing Games

According to recent industry reports, the global market value for fishing games is projected to reach approximately USD 2.1 billion by 2025, with a compounded ann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 8%. This growth is driven by a combination of mobile accessibility, integration of augmented reality (AR), and increasingly realistic gameplay features. In the UK specifically, survey data indicates that over 12% of gamers aged 18-34 participate regularly in virtual fishing activities, reflecting a steady demand that caters to both casual and dedicated audiences.

Key factors fueling this expansion include enhanced user experience, community-driven competitions, and innovative monetization models that balance genuine gameplay with rewarding microtransactions. Major developers are investing heavily in data-driven personalization, enabling tailored content that boosts retention and lifetime value.

Technological Innovations Reshaping the Industry

The technological backbone supporting these advancements involves complex algorithms, real-time graphics rendering, and AI-powered NPCs (non-player characters). For example, adaptive AI can now modify fishing difficulty based on player skill, creating a more engaging experience. Moreover, the incorporation of AR allows players to fish within their real-world environment via smartphones or AR glasses, blurring the line between virtual and physical worlds.

The Role of Data and Gaming Communities in Industry Growth

Data analytics have become indispensable in creating compelling, competitive digital fishing environments. By analysing player behaviour, developers refine game mechanics, optimize in-game economy, and design targeted updates that resonate with user interests. Looking Ahead: Challenges and Opportunities

Despite the buoyant outlook, the industry faces challenges such as regulatory scrutiny concerning monetization practices, the need for robust cybersecurity, and the handling of user data privacy. However, these hurdles present opportunities for responsible innovation and ethical game design.

Future developments might include more seamless integration of AI-driven content, personalized virtual ecosystems, and expanded use of blockchain technology to ensure fair play and ownership of digital assets.
